OK, I am thinking I do not have any available RS232 channels. I have a SL30, encoder out, Garmin 430W, and Arinc429 converter for the AFS autopilot. How can I use the Navworx ADS-B receiver?
I know Channel 2 has an input available. (only outputs to the transponder)
Channel 1 has the 430 serial input, Is the output line available?
Channel 3 SL30
Channel 4 Arinc adapter.
OR
I have a single screen set up. Could I add a second screen and input to the new unit?
Last edited by AltonD; 02-04-2011 at 11:53 AM.
It sounds like you are limited on inputs with that single screen. The cheapest option would probably be to buy a separate altitude encoder which free's up serial #2 for the ADS-600B. A second screen would give you 4 additional ports to utilize. At some point we will eliminate the need for serial data from the GNS-430/530 (only using ARINC).
